ResMAE Suspends Originations

By: PAUL JACKSON
November 6, 2007

related

Advertisements

ResMAE Mortgage Corporation has halted all origination activity, according to a notice posted on the company’s Web site this evening:

As of November 6, 2007, ResMAE Mortgage Corporation temporarily ceased all new loan origination activity. ResMAE is no longer accepting new mortgage loan applications, but will continue to honor commitments placed with ResMAE before November 6th as required by ResMAE policy and state requirements.

The company did not provide a reason for the suspension, or any further information on whether funding might resume at a future date.

The lender has a recent history of trouble, having filed for bankruptcy protection in February. An affiliate of Citadel Investment Group bested Credit Suisse in bidding for the troubled lender in March, in a deal worth an estimated $180 million. The company exited Chapter 11 in June, saying it was resuming normal operations.
